Three months after the auto accident that sidelined him for weeks, Boney James is sharing details of what happened. In an interview with the Richmond Times Dispatch, he recalls the night a drunk driver rear-ended him on the way home after a show. He was on speakerphone with his wife when it happened. "OnStar came on and knocked my wife off, so she didn't know what was happening. Then the guy's car caught on fire, so someone was banging on my door, telling me to get out because [the other] car was going to blow. I couldn't open my door, so I went out the passenger side. It was pretty scary . . . but I feel super grateful that it wasn't worse."
James says his recovery continues along with his current summer tour dates. "I feel pretty normal now. Just a little achy when I play…But on the whole, things are pretty good. The teeth aren't exactly where they were, but I'm adjusting. I'm just so glad to be back up there on stage.”
